This is reported by RIA Novosti with reference to the Russian Consulate General in Chennai.

The diplomatic agency noted that due to the coronavirus pandemic, India remains closed to Russians.

According to the consulate, there are no Russian passport numbers on the passenger list.

“Most likely, our citizens were not on this flight,” said Yuri Belov, press attaché of the Russian Consulate General in Chennai.

On August 7, an Air India plane, on board which, according to some sources, there were 191 people, rolled off the runway in India.

According to media reports, 14 people died and dozens were injured.

The Department of the Situation and Crisis Center of the Russian Foreign Ministry reported that diplomats are investigating whether Russian citizens were on board the plane.
